9 Jesus Preached About the Kingdom Throughout His Ministry  Matt 4:17 = THE BEGINNING “From that time Jesus began to preach and say, ‘Repent, for the kingdom of heaven is at hand.’”  Matt 26:29 = THE END “But I say to you, I will not drink of this fruit of the vine from now on until that day when I drink it new with you in My Father's kingdom.”

10 Jesus Used The “Church” and “Kingdom” Interchangeable  Matt 16:18 = Church “And I also say to you that you are Peter, and upon this rock I will build My church.”  Matt 16:19 = Kingdom “I will give you the keys of the kingdom of heaven.”

11 The Church and Kingdom Have the Same Beginning Date  Mark 9:1 = Kingdom Will Come With Power “Truly I say to you, there are some of those who are standing here who shall not taste death until they see the kingdom of God after it has come with power.”  Acts 1:8 = Apostles Would Receive Power. “But you shall receive power when the Holy Spirit has come upon you.”

12 The Church and Kingdom Have the Same Beginning Date  Acts 2:4 = Apostles Received Power on Pentecost “They were all filled with the Holy Spirit and began to speak with other tongues, as the Spirit was giving them utterance.”  When Did the Church Begin?  The Same Day.

13 The Church and Kingdom Have the Same Beginning Location  The Church and Kingdom Began On the Same Day In JERUSALEM.  Acts 11:15 “And as I began to speak, the Holy Spirit fell upon them, just as He did upon us at the beginning.”

14 The Church and Kingdom Were Both Purchased With Christ’s Blood  Rev. 5:9-10 = Kingdom Purchased “You were slain, and purchased for God with Your blood men from every tribe and tongue and people and nation. You have made them to be a kingdom and priests to our God.”  Acts 20:28 = Church Purchased “To shepherd the church of God which He purchased with His own blood.”

15 If We Had Time  They Have the Same King and Law  Eph. 5:24 = The Church is Subject to Christ  1 Cor. 15:24 = The Kingdom is subject to Christ and His Rule.  They Have the Same Memorial  1 Cor. 1:2; 11:23ff = The Church Observed the Lord’s Supper.  Matt. 26:29 = Christ Partakes of the Supper in the Kingdom.

16 Still Not Convinced?  Col 1:13 “For He delivered us from the domain of darkness, and transferred us to the kingdom of His beloved Son.”
